The island of Ré, in front of La Rochelle, and bathed by the Atlantic ocean, offers all the year a micro climate, her main city and her historic citadel of Saint Martin de Ré is today, an incomparable charming village, organized around the harbour and protected by some fortifications, imagined by Vauban. Fishing, yachting, biking, discovery of the ornithological reserve, gastronomy, vineyard and fruits and vegetables early, products of oyster farming, beach and salt marshs, soil and protected nature, here are the numerous touristic advantages of this jewel of the coast.
